gpt4 book ai didi

html - 离线 HTML 模板

转载 作者:技术小花猫 更新时间:2023-10-29 12:54:51 25 4
gpt4 key购买 nike

我正在设计一个没有动态内容的简单网站,我希望它轻巧便携 — 不需要或不需要 PHP 或其他服务器端脚本。我遇到了一个我之前遇到过几次的问题。

我希望能够编写一次公共(public)元素(头、脚、导航),然后只用内容编写站点上的各个页面,然后运行这个神秘的实用程序将所有内容编译成一组准备就绪的 HTML 文件用于上传。一个页面可能是这样写的:

Title: Our ServicesTop Navigation: YesScripts: jquery, lightbox<p>    Example, Inc. offers a wide range of…

It'd be great if the engine also had logic that lets me include or exclude elements (like Top Navigation above) from each page, and automate tasks like labelling the current page in the navbar:

<a href="/services"{page == 'services' ? ' class="current"' : ""}>Services</a>

有这样的引擎吗?

最佳答案

我会直接前往 Template-Toolkit为了这。它带有 ttree用于构建静态站点的实用程序。

您可以用类似的方式处理问题的最后一部分:

[% 
INCLUDE 'navbar.tt'
page = 'services'
%]

关于html - 离线 HTML 模板,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2204035/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com